好文推荐:深入分析Java线程池的实现原理

如果被无限制的创建,不仅会消耗系统资源,还会降低系统的稳定性。合理的使用线程池对线程进行统一分配、调优和监控,有以下好处:1、降低资源消耗。

十年程序员分享:java线程池的实现原理深入分析

前言线程是稀缺资源,如果被无限制的创建,不仅会消耗系统资源,还会降低系统的稳定性。合理的使用线程池对线程进行统一分配、调优和监控,有以下好处:1、降低资源消耗。

Java,XXL-JOB,作业/任务调度,使用方法,了解入门

XXL-JOBXXL-JOB是一个轻量级分布式任务调度平台,其核心设计目标是开发迅速、学习简单、轻量级、易扩展。现已开放源代码并接入多家公司线上产品线,开箱即用。XXL-JOB官方文档:https://www.xuxueli.

Java高并发系列-先从上帝的角度看一下并发包JUC

1. 概述java.util.concurrent包提供了创建并发应用程序的工具。在本文中,我们将对整个包进行概述。2. 主要组件该java.util.

JAVA编程核心技术之接口以及用法

小编带领小伙伴们来看一下异步任务执行服务的基本接口、用法和实现原理。基本接口首先,我们来看任务执行服务涉及的基本接口:·Runnable和Callable:表示要执行的异步任务。·Executor和ExecutorService:表示执行服务。·Future:表示异步任务的结果。

「java实战系列」多线程开发|基础篇|第三讲|线程池的使用

前面两篇文章,对java开启线程,以及线程的状态做了简要分析。通过分析不难发现,通过 继承Thread类、实现Runnable接口、实现Callable接口这三种方式不仅复杂,而且可能带来不可预估的线程问题。本章着重对第四种方式:线程池开启多线程的方式进行探讨。

深入理解 MyBatis的二级缓存的设计原理

它可以提高对数据库查询的效率,以提高应用的性能。当开一个会话时,一个SqlSession对象会使用一个Executor对象来完成会话操作。

由浅入深理解Java线程池及线程池的如何使用

多线程的异步执行方式,虽然能够最大限度发挥多核计算机的计算能力,但是如果不加控制,反而会对系统造成负担。

带你学会区分Scheduled Thread Pool Executor 与Timer

此账号为华为云开发者社区官方运营账号,提供全面深入的云计算前景分析、丰富的技术干货、程序样例,分享华为云前沿资讯动态本文分享自华为云社区《【高并发】ScheduledThreadPoolExecutor与Timer的区别和简单示例》,作者:冰 河 。JDK 1.

Java并发类库提供的线程池有哪几种? 分别有什么特点?

Executor 框架Java提供的线程池框架主要涉及到如下的类和接口:Executors: 通过很多静态方法,提供不同的预配置的线程池;Executor: Executor 是最上层的接口,只包含execute方法;ExecutorService: Executor的子接口;包

网站地图